#B1549E Hex color

#B1549E

The hexadecimal color code #B1549E corresponds to the code RGB( 177, 84, 158 ). It's a shade of Pink. This color is a combination of red (at 0,69 level), green (at 0,33 level) and blue (at 0,62 level). Its brightness is 51% and its saturation is 37%. It is composed of red at 42%, green at 20% and blue at 37%.
